Responsible for developing and implementing a marketing strategy for the program. Responsible for developing marketing initiatives, collaborative opportunities, partnership requests, brand structure and guidelines, and maintaining internal and external-facing marketing mediums, including online strategy, website development, marketing tools and conference presence.

Areas of Responsibility: 
  • Creates, manages and executes marketing plans for assigned program such as internal communications, consumer marketing, web and social media marketing
  • Manages the development of marketing collateral across digital/interactive, social media, webinars and live events
  • Designs and compiles materials for online publications. Creates and updates digital marketing platforms
  • Manages vendor/agency relationships to ensure effective execution and timely delivery of program components
  • Partners and executes projects with existing AHA programs and initiatives. Facilitates marketing campaign prioritization in collaboration with internal stakeholders and establishes long-term integrated marketing plans aligned to the unique needs of the community engagement program.
  • Collaborates with Communications team to execute timely promotions. Evaluates and maintains brand integrity and evolving needs
  • Collaborates with other AHA departments on reporting and status updates that will provide visibility into marketing campaign results and measure effectiveness, including lead generation, opportunity creation, pipeline contribution and ROI of marketing efforts within the program.
Educational Background: 
Bachelor's degree or equivalent work experience in marketing, communications, advertising or journalism
Skills/Experience: 
  • 5 years of experience managing marketing programs involving integrated marketing communications
  • Proven track record of creating and executing integrated marketing campaigns using tactics that include live events, webinars, email marketing, digital advertising and social media
  • Excellent project management skills

Mission: 

The American Heart Association's mission is to build healthier lives free of cardiovascular diseases and stroke, America's No. 1 and No. 5 killers.

Founded in 1924, our organization now includes more than 30 million volunteers and supporters. We fund innovative research, fight for stronger public health policies, and provide critical tools and information to save and improve lives.
